Allison Cara Tolman has been an actor for more than twenty years. Her character, Molly Solverson, in season one of FX's Fargo the television show, earned her nominations for Emmy as well as Golden Globe. Tolman was born in New York City and is the mother of two older and one younger brothers. Her family relocated to England at the age of couple of months old, and she stuck around until she turned four years old. She lived for the next five years in Oklahoma and West Texas, before moving to Sugar Land, Texas. At the age of ten actress, she began acting in the Fort Bend Community Theatre. Clements High School graduated her in 2000. Baylor University granted her a bachelor's degree in Fine Arts with an emphasis on the performance of the stage. In Dallas when she graduated from the college level, she was one of the founders of Second Thought Theatre. She moved into Chicago in 2009 to attend The Second City Training Center for a course in acting. Tolman gained fame in 2014 as Tolman appeared on FX's Fargo.
